Who Is Dustin Hurt? A Quick Look
Dustin Hurt, you know, is a person who wears many hats. He is, in fact, an American contractor, and he has spent time as a wildland firefighter, which is a very demanding job. Most people, though, know him as a reality TV personality, especially from his work on the Gold Rush shows. He is a gold miner, that is for sure, and he has a lot of experience with heavy machinery, over 23 years of it, actually.
He was born and grew up in the United States, with his father, Dakota Fred, and his mother, Lorrayne Hurt. Sadly, his mother passed away on February 2nd, 2015, after being sick for a while. His father, Dakota Fred, told everyone about her passing by sharing a photo of Dustin, which was a very touching thing to do.

Dustin Hurt's Career Path: From Construction to Gold
Dustin Hurt's career, it's pretty clear, started out in construction. He learned a lot working under his father, Fred Hurt, which gave him a strong foundation. Before he joined the Gold Rush show, he also spent some time working for the California Forest Service, so he has a background in public service and, you know, handling tough outdoor situations. This experience as a wildland firefighter, you can imagine, would be very useful when you are dealing with the wild places where gold is found.
His move into gold mining, then, feels like a natural step, especially with his father being such a big name in that field. He is, basically, a heavy machinery operation expert, and that is a skill that is absolutely essential for gold mining. You need to know how to handle those big machines to move earth and rock, and he has more than two decades of experience doing just that. Leading the Dakota Boys: Taking Over the Family Business
After his father, Fred Hurt, passed away, Dustin, you know, stepped up to lead the mining operation. He is now managing the crew and also handling the gold extractions on Gold Rush. This is a big responsibility, especially since his father was so experienced and well-known in the mining world. It's a bit like taking over a very established business, with all the expectations that come with it.
Dustin, together with his crew, has to tackle some really difficult situations to get gold from dangerous waters. White Water, a show that started in 2018 and had eight seasons, really shows some of the most extreme gold mining ever on TV. It is a very intense way to find gold, and it requires a lot of skill and courage, you know, to work in those kinds of conditions.
There was this one time, during an April 7th episode of Gold Rush, when the crew was really struggling to make enough money. Then, they found an extraordinary nugget, which was estimated to be worth more than $20,000. That find, you see, was a huge boost, and many on the team felt it was Fred Hurt's way of saying thanks to them, which is a very touching thought.
The Challenges of White Water: Extreme Gold Mining
Gold Rush: White Water, as mentioned, is a reality television series that first aired on the Discovery Channel in 2018. It shows a type of gold mining that is, well, very different and arguably more dangerous than what you might see on the main Gold Rush show. It focuses on extracting gold from perilous waters, which means dealing with strong currents, deep pools, and very tricky terrain. This is where Dustin Hurt really shines, leading his team through these very difficult conditions.
Fans of the show, in the comments, often talk about how intense it is. Some people, you know, even say the group can seem a bit delusional at times, given the risks they take. But, honestly, the show highlights the incredible effort and perseverance it takes to find gold in such extreme environments. It is not just about digging; it is about managing a team, keeping everyone safe, and making smart decisions when things get really tough.
Dustin, for instance, even incurred a devastating injury during the season 8 premiere of Gold Rush. He thought he broke something in his hand while working on the pulley system for his equipment.
